Position details:
* Part-time, 30 hours/week
* Starting October 01, 2025, with a duration of 5 years
Would you like to study a topic in organizational control and incentive systems in depth as part of a dissertation? Join a team dedicated to excellence in research and teaching, and contribute to this field in an open and appreciative environment.
What to expect
* Writing a dissertation: Investigate your research topic and dedicate one-third of your working hours to dissertation writing.
* Develop scientific working methods: Initially, assist experienced researchers with publications; later, publish conference papers and journal articles. Our team will introduce you to empirical-quantitative methods, working with different researchers depending on your topic.
* Gain teaching experience: Be integrated into teaching activities from the start, including project courses with partner companies, primarily in English.
* Work in a team: Collaborate with around 15 academic staff, with networking opportunities through workshops and seminars with international researchers.
* Connect with the global scientific community: Present research at major conferences and possibly undertake research stays abroad.
* Team development: Participate in research projects, publications, and events to deepen your expertise and foster professional growth.
* Organizational tasks: Assist in organizing courses, maintaining student community, and supporting research projects.
Candidate requirements
* Academic degree: Master’s or diploma qualifying for doctoral studies at WU.
* Knowledge: Expertise in financial management, governance, organizational and HR management, strategic management, or microeconomics; experience in scientific research is advantageous.
* Languages: Fluent in German and English.
* Teaching methods: Willing to use multimedia formats.
* IT skills: Proficiency in MS Office; experience with Stata, Python, R, or survey software is a plus.
* Commitment: Self-motivated, independent, and proactive.
